In Pound, Wisconsin, the risk of water damage is shaped by its northern freeze climate and the unique characteristics of this small community of 379 residents. With a median home age of about 53 years, most properties feature aging copper plumbing that is vulnerable to the extreme freeze conditions prevalent between November and April. This period brings a heightened chance of burst frozen pipes, a common cause of serious water damage here. Ice dams also pose a significant threat to roofs, especially in homes where snowmelt cannot properly drain, leading to leaks that can compromise structural integrity. Additionally, spring snowmelt flooding frequently affects basements, exacerbated by occasional sump pump failures in this rural area with a population density of 148 per square mile. While FEMA rates Pound’s water disaster risk as low, the town has experienced six FEMA water-related disasters historically, including three since 2010, underscoring the need for vigilance. The median household income of $70,714 contrasts sharply with the potential cost of major water damage—up to $47,100—which represents 67% of annual income and over a third of the median home value of $123,571. Both homeowners, who make up nearly 79% of residents, and renters face significant exposure. The cold, dry air of Pound can aid in drying after water intrusion, but heated interiors often create condensation, posing a moderate drying challenge and elevating mold risk. Given Pound’s remote location, 40 miles from Green Bay, response delays make pre-planning for these water damage risks especially crucial.

Shut off the main water valve if it's a pipe. If it's storm-related, move to step 2. Don't enter standing water near electrical outlets.
Turn off breakers to any room with standing water. If the breaker panel is in the flooded area, call your utility company first.
Photograph and video all damage before touching anything. Your insurance claim depends on evidence of initial conditions.
Don't wait. In Pound's climate, mold begins colonizing within 24–48 hours. The faster pros start extraction, the lower the total cost.
Move electronics, documents, and irreplaceable items to dry areas. Lift furniture off wet carpet with aluminum foil under the legs.

In Pound, Wisconsin, the moderate mold risk following water damage is influenced by the town’s northern freeze climate and annual precipitation of 33.1 inches. The cold winters, lasting from November through April, slow mold growth due to freezing temperatures; however, the transition to warmer months can accelerate mold proliferation, particularly in homes where spring snowmelt causes basement flooding. With a median home age of 53 years, many properties feature construction materials and plumbing that may be more susceptible to lingering moisture, especially when combined with heated interiors that create condensation. For Pound’s residents—both homeowners and renters—this means mold can develop within days, posing health risks such as respiratory irritation and allergic reactions, which are particularly concerning for the town’s median age of 36, reflecting a working-age population often caring for children or elderly family members. Preventing mold requires prompt drying and moisture control within 24 to 48 hours of water intrusion, a challenge given the town’s remote location 40 miles from Green Bay and longer contractor response times. Professional remediation becomes necessary if mold spreads extensively or impacts indoor air quality, emphasizing the need for early detection and intervention tailored to Pound’s specific environmental and demographic conditions.
